- Peanut Wood is not really peanut wood; peanuts
grow undergound and not on a tree. It is
called "peanut" wood because of the peanut-shape cream color
inclusions. These "peanuts" used to be holes left behind by
burrowing teredo mollusks. These holes filled with matter which was
eventually replaced by chert when the wood fossilized.
